#include "PlcNonBlockingParser.h"
PlcNonBlockingParser::PlcNonBlockingParser(int symbolMaxLength)
{
symbol = (char*)malloc(symbolMaxLength);
beginParse();
maxParseLength = symbolMaxLength;;
}
void PlcNonBlockingParser::beginParse()
{
intNumber = 0;
isNegative = false;
isFraction = false;
fraction = 1.0;
*symbol = 0;
az = 0;
length = 0;
complete = false;
}
bool PlcNonBlockingParser::isSkip(char c)
{
return true;
}
int PlcNonBlockingParser::parseNumber(char c)
{
if (isFraction)
{
fraction *= 0.1;
}
if (c == '-')
{
isNegative = true;
return 1;
}
if (c >= '0' && c <= '9')
{
intNumber = intNumber * 10 + c - '0';
return 1;
}
if (c == '.' || c == ',')
{
isFraction = true;
return 1;
}
return 0;
}
double PlcNonBlockingParser::getDouble()
{
if (isNegative)
{
return -(intNumber * fraction);
}
else
{
return intNumber * fraction;
}
}
int PlcNonBlockingParser::getInt()
{
if (isFraction)
{
return (int)getDouble();
}
if (isNegative)
{
return -(intNumber * fraction);
}
else
{
return intNumber * fraction;
}
}
bool PlcNonBlockingParser::acceptChar(char c)
{
if (c == '-') return true;
if (c == '.') return true;
if (c == ',') return true;
if (c >= 48 && c <= 57) return true;
if (c >= 65 && c <= 122) return true;
return false;
}
bool PlcNonBlockingParser::parseToken(char c)
{
if (complete)
{
return true;
}
if (c == ' ')
{
az = c;
return false;
}
if (!acceptChar(c))
{
complete = true;
az = c;
return true;;
}
if (length > maxParseLength)
{
complete = true;
az = c;
return true;
}
az = c;
symbol[length] = az;
//symbol += c;
//symbol.append(1, c);
parseNumber(c);
length++;
symbol[length] = 0;
return false;
}
bool PlcNonBlockingParser::parseToken(PlcStream* stream)
{
if (complete) return true;
if (stream == NULL) return 0;
if (stream->availableIntern())
{
int r = stream->readIntern();
if (r < 0)
{
return false;
}
parseToken(r);
if (complete) return true;
}
return complete;
}
void PlcNonBlockingParser::endParse()
{
double d = getDouble();
int i = getInt();
int u = 0;
}
